About The Position

The Vice President, Growth Initiatives will be directly responsible for the Securitech, Arrow, Lawrence, and Behavioral Health business segments which have the capability for rapid growth as well as lead the Marketing & Digital Content group for all the Access and Egress Hardware (AEH) brands. This leader will partner closely with Sales, Business Development, Product Management, Engineering, Operations, and P&L owners to deliver revenue and margin expansion through disciplined execution and cross-brand alignment. The position reports directly to the President, Access & Egress Hardware Group and is based at our Connecticut facilities.
